Questions & Answers

What companies run services between Heathrow, England and Bletchley, England?

You can take a train from Heathrow Terminals 2 & 3 to Bletchley via Tottenham Court Road Station, Tottenham Court Road station, Euston station, and London Euston in around 1h 47m. Alternatively, FlixBus operates a bus from London Heathrow Airport to Milton Keynes every 4 hours. Tickets cost £6–12 and the journey takes 1h 55m.
